Parsons et al. Are doing a study comparing differences in brain activity levels between patients with schizophrenia and controls
Soloha48 [4]

Answer:Functional magnetic resonance imaging or functional MRI (fMRI)

Explanation:Functional magnetic resonance imaging or functional MRI (fMRI) is a technique used to measure activities that occurs in the brain by detecting how the blood flow changes. It is based on the fact that blood flow and neuronal activation occur together.
